Dan’s has been around since before most of us were born. A trip to the Allentown Farmer’s Market would not be complete without seeing racks upon racks of golden brown crispy whole chickens roasting on spits filling the air with fragrant aromas of bar-b-qued meat. Honestly, I haven’t tried anything they have to offer until recently. I ordered a whole roasted chicken and about two lbs of ribs. The chicken was delicious with moist and crisy skin. The ribs were well charred, but it was«gnaw the meat off the bone» doneness. Not the«fall off the bone tender» I was expecting. At around $ 10.00 a LB(for the ribs) definitely not worth it. Go for the chicken, though… They do have a nice seating area you can eat your dinner and watch the show of patrons/oddities passing by.
